Frequently asked questions
What is the lug width of the IWC Portofino IW3563-06?
The lug width of the IWC Portofino IW3563-06 is 20 millimetres. This dimension is specific to this 39mm case configuration and represents the standard for all examples of this reference. To verify precisely, measure the distance between the spring bar holes using a digital calliper.

How do I change the strap on the IWC Portofino IW3563-06?
The Portofino uses spring bar attachments. Equip yourself with a spring bar tool, insert the curved tip into the lateral hole of the lug, compress the internal spring and remove the pin. How long does a leather strap last on a watch like the Portofino?
Lifespan depends on usage and materials. An alligator strap with vegetable tanning lasts 3-5 years with daily wear; shell cordovan can exceed 5-7 years. Regenerated calf tends to wear faster (2-3 years), whilst technical rubber can last 5-8 years. Rotating between multiple straps significantly extends the life of each.
